Soot Damage Restoration in Marin County, CA

Soot damage restoration services focus on cleaning and repairing properties affected by soot residue resulting from fires, smoke, or other combustion sources. These services typically involve removing soot deposits from surfaces such as walls, ceilings, HVAC systems, and personal belongings. Property owners often seek this type of restoration after fire incidents or smoke-related events, aiming to restore the cleanliness and safety of their homes or commercial spaces. Understanding the extent of soot damage and the types of affected materials is essential before requesting services, as different cleaning methods may be required depending on the severity and location of the residue.

Before requesting soot damage restoration, property owners usually want to know about the scope of cleaning needed and the types of materials involved, such as upholstery, carpets, or structural elements. They may also inquire about the potential for odor removal and the timeline for completing the cleanup process. Clarifying these details helps ensure that the restoration addresses all affected areas effectively and restores the property to its pre-damage condition. Proper assessment and communication are key to achieving thorough cleaning and minimizing residual soot or smoke odors.

FAQ

Soot Damage Restoration Questions

What causes soot damage in homes? Soot damage typically results from fires, including cooking accidents, electrical fires, or heating system malfunctions.

How does soot affect property surfaces? Soot can stain walls, ceilings, and furniture, and may cause lingering odors if not properly cleaned.

What are common services for soot damage restoration? Services often include surface cleaning, odor removal, and deep cleaning of affected areas to restore property appearance and safety.

Is soot damage repair safe for sensitive materials? Proper cleaning methods ensure that delicate surfaces and materials are preserved while removing soot residues effectively.
